| Feature | Useme | Remotify (Best Alternative) |
| Headquarters | Poland | Estonia (EU fintech hub) |
| USP | Deliverables-based, client must prepay | Invoice without company, bulk payments, MOR model |
| Currencies | 4 (EUR, USD, PLN, GBP) | 100+ local currencies |
| Payout options | Bank transfer, PayPal, SEPA, SWIFT | SEPA, SWIFT, Wise, Revolut, Payoneer, local rails |
| Hidden fees | Dynamic service fee + FX conversion | No hidden fees, transparent % only |
| Fees | 0.99–4.6% + FX costs | From 2.5% (typ. ~4%), volume discounts |
| Bulk payment | ❌ | ✔️ pay many freelancers in one go |
| One invoice | ❌ | ✔️ one VAT-compliant invoice for all |
| Recurring invoices | ❌ | ✔️ |
| Invoice reminders | ❌ | ✔️ |
| Setup | Manual check ~24h | Instant ~10 min signup |
